DEFINITION - Master data management (MDM) is a comprehensive approach to linking all an enterprise's data elements. The goal of MDM is to streamline data sharing and provide everyone in the enterprise with a single, consistent view of critical data by using both technology and data governance techniques.

The kinds of information treated as master data varies from industry to industry and from one organization to another. The technology itself acts as middleware and gives systems a common place to look for approved data definitions. For MDM to function at its best, MDM must be driven by a tight working relationship between business and IT.

The benefits of the MDM paradigm increase as the number and diversity of organizational departments, worker roles and computing applications expand. For this reason, MDM is more likely to be of value to large or complex enterprises than to small, medium-sized or simple ones. MDM can facilitate computing in multiple system architectures, platforms and applications. When companies merge, the implementation of MDM can minimize confusion and optimize the efficiency of the new, larger organization.
